What is Soy Sauce?
Before we jump into the how-to, let's quickly touch on what soy sauce actually is. At its heart, soy sauce is a fermented condiment made from soybeans, wheat, salt, and a fermenting agent, typically a mold. This magical fermentation process is what gives soy sauce its characteristic rich, savory flavor and dark color. Think of it as the umami bomb that elevates countless dishes, from stir-fries and marinades to sushi and dipping sauces. The history of soy sauce stretches back centuries, originating in ancient China, where it was a way to preserve food. Over time, different regions developed their own unique methods and flavors, leading to the diverse range of soy sauces we see today, such as the Japanese shoyu and the Indonesian kecap manis. Ingredients You'll Need
Alright, let's gather our ingredients! Making soy sauce at home requires a few key components, and the quality of these ingredients will directly impact the final flavor of your sauce. Here's what you'll need:
- Soybeans: The star of the show! You'll want to use whole soybeans, preferably organic and non-GMO. Different varieties of soybeans can impart slightly different flavors, so feel free to experiment. Generally, a good quality soybean will yield a richer, more flavorful soy sauce. Make sure they are clean and free from any debris before you start.
- Wheat: Wheat provides carbohydrates for the fermenting microorganisms to feed on, contributing to the sweetness and complexity of the sauce. Traditionally, roasted wheat is used, which adds a nutty aroma and deeper color. You can use whole wheat berries and roast them yourself, or purchase pre-roasted wheat from specialty stores. The roasting process is crucial, as it not only develops flavor but also helps to sterilize the wheat.
- Salt: Salt plays a crucial role in the fermentation process, controlling the growth of unwanted bacteria and contributing to the overall flavor and preservation of the soy sauce. Use a good quality sea salt or kosher salt, as these are free from additives that can affect the taste. The amount of salt used is critical, as it influences the fermentation rate and the final saltiness of the sauce.
- Aspergillus mold: This is the secret ingredient that makes soy sauce truly special. Aspergillus is a type of mold that produces enzymes that break down the proteins and carbohydrates in soybeans and wheat, creating the characteristic flavors and aromas of soy sauce. You can purchase Aspergillus oryzae or Aspergillus sojae cultures from specialty fermentation suppliers. Using the correct type of mold is essential for a successful fermentation. Don't try to substitute with other types of mold, as they may not produce the desired results and could even be harmful.
- Water: Clean, filtered water is essential for the fermentation process. Avoid using tap water that contains chlorine or other chemicals, as these can inhibit the growth of the Aspergillus mold. The water provides the necessary moisture for the fermentation to occur and helps to dissolve the salt and other ingredients.

Step-by-Step Guide to Making Soy Sauce

Step 1: Prepare the Soybeans and Wheat
- Soak the Soybeans: Rinse the soybeans and soak them in plenty of water for at least 8 hours, or preferably overnight. This will help to rehydrate the beans and make them easier to cook. The soybeans will swell up considerably, so make sure you use a large enough container. Soaking also helps to remove some of the bitter compounds from the soybeans.
- Cook the Soybeans: Drain the soaked soybeans and either steam them for about 2-3 hours, or boil them in water for about 3-4 hours, until they are very soft and easily mashed. The soybeans should be cooked until they are tender enough to be crushed between your fingers. Steaming is the preferred method, as it helps to retain more of the flavor and nutrients. Boiling can leach some of the flavor into the water.
- Roast the Wheat: While the soybeans are cooking, roast the wheat in a dry skillet or in the oven at 300°F (150°C) for about 1 hour, or until it is lightly browned and fragrant. Roasting the wheat develops its flavor and helps to sterilize it. Stir the wheat occasionally to ensure even roasting. The wheat should have a nutty aroma and a slightly toasted appearance.
- Grind the Wheat: After roasting, grind the wheat into a coarse powder using a grain mill or a food processor. You don't need to grind it into a fine flour; a coarse texture is ideal. Grinding the wheat increases its surface area, making it easier for the Aspergillus mold to break it down.
Step 2: Inoculate with Aspergillus Mold
- Cool the Soybeans and Wheat: Allow the cooked soybeans and roasted wheat to cool to about 80-90°F (27-32°C). This is important because high temperatures can kill the Aspergillus mold. You can spread the soybeans and wheat out on large trays to help them cool more quickly.
- Mix the Soybeans and Wheat: Combine the cooled soybeans and wheat in a large bowl. Mix them thoroughly to ensure that the mold will be evenly distributed. The mixture should be relatively dry, not soggy.
- Inoculate with Aspergillus: Sprinkle the Aspergillus mold spores over the soybean and wheat mixture. Follow the instructions provided with your culture for the correct amount to use. Mix the spores in thoroughly, ensuring that they are evenly distributed throughout the mixture. This is a crucial step, as the Aspergillus mold is responsible for the fermentation process.
- Incubate the Koji: Spread the inoculated mixture (called koji) on large trays or containers and incubate it at a temperature of 80-90°F (27-32°C) for about 3-5 days. You'll need to maintain a high humidity level during this incubation period. You can do this by placing the trays in a humidified room or by covering them with damp cloths. The koji should develop a white, fuzzy mold growth during this time. This is the Aspergillus mold growing and producing enzymes. Turn the koji mixture occasionally to ensure even growth.
Step 3: Prepare the Moromi
- Make a Salt Brine: Dissolve the salt in the water to create a brine solution. The salt concentration should be around 18-20%. This high salt concentration is important for controlling the growth of unwanted bacteria during fermentation. Use a good quality sea salt or kosher salt for the best flavor.
- Combine Koji and Brine: Transfer the koji to your fermentation vessel and pour the salt brine over it. Mix well to ensure that the koji is fully submerged in the brine. This mixture is called the moromi.
Step 4: Ferment the Moromi
- Ferment the Moromi: Cover the fermentation vessel loosely to allow air to circulate but prevent contamination. A cheesecloth or a lid with air vents is ideal. Place the vessel in a cool, dark place with a temperature of 70-80°F (21-27°C). Ferment the moromi for at least 6 months, or preferably 1-2 years. The longer the fermentation, the richer and more complex the flavor will be. Stir the moromi occasionally during the first few months to ensure even fermentation.
Step 5: Press and Pasteurize
- Press the Moromi: After fermentation, line a colander with cheesecloth and pour the moromi into it. Gather the edges of the cheesecloth and tie them together to form a bag. Place the bag in a press or place a weight on top of it to extract the liquid soy sauce. This process can take several hours or even overnight.
- Pasteurize the Soy Sauce (Optional): Pasteurizing the soy sauce will kill any remaining microorganisms and help to stabilize the flavor. Heat the soy sauce to 175-185°F (80-85°C) for 20-30 minutes. This step is optional, but it will extend the shelf life of your soy sauce.
Step 6: Bottle and Enjoy
- Bottle the Soy Sauce: Pour the finished soy sauce into clean, sterilized bottles. Glass bottles are ideal. Store the soy sauce in a cool, dark place. Homemade soy sauce can last for several years if stored properly.

Tips for Success
Making soy sauce is a journey, not a race! Here are a few tips to help you along the way and ensure your homemade soy sauce is a smashing success:
- Sanitation is Key: This cannot be stressed enough! Cleanliness is crucial in fermentation to prevent unwanted bacteria and molds from taking over. Sterilize all your equipment thoroughly before you begin. Use boiling water or a food-safe sanitizer.
- Temperature Control: Maintaining the correct temperature during incubation and fermentation is vital for the Aspergillus mold to thrive. Use a thermometer to monitor the temperature and adjust as needed. If the temperature is too low, the fermentation will be slow. If it's too high, the mold may die.
- Patience is a Virtue: Soy sauce fermentation takes time – months, even years! Don't rush the process. The longer you ferment, the more complex and flavorful your sauce will be. Think of it as an investment in deliciousness.
- Taste as You Go: Sample your soy sauce periodically during fermentation to track the flavor development. This will give you a sense of how the flavors are evolving and when the sauce is ready to be pressed. The flavor should become richer and more complex over time.

Troubleshooting
Fermentation can be a bit unpredictable, so it's good to be prepared for potential hiccups. Here are some common issues you might encounter and how to address them:
- Unwanted Mold Growth: If you see any mold growth that isn't white and fuzzy (like green, black, or pink), it's best to discard the batch. These molds can be harmful. Proper sanitation is the best way to prevent unwanted mold growth.
- Slow Fermentation: If your moromi isn't fermenting as quickly as you expected, it could be due to low temperature, low salt concentration, or inactive Aspergillus mold. Make sure the temperature is in the optimal range, and check the salt concentration. You may need to add more salt or a fresh culture of Aspergillus mold.
- Off-Flavors: If your soy sauce has a sour or bitter taste, it could be due to over-fermentation or the growth of unwanted bacteria. Taste the soy sauce periodically during fermentation to monitor the flavor. If you detect off-flavors, you may need to shorten the fermentation time or discard the batch.
